If you follow, down around the stream
Past the old birch tree
And around the windy bridge
You’ll see her tucked away
Hidden if you arent looking for her
In a small fairy house
In the corner of the woods
You’ll need to sneak up on her
Or she’ll hear you coming and run away even longer
Illusive and frustrating at times
Yet when you can connect
And meet on mutual terms
You’ll conspire with one of the most creative muses there is
And when you find her…
Tell her I’ve been ~impatiently~ awaiting her return
